     33 """A conformance test implementation for the Python protobuf library.
     34 
     35 See conformance.proto for more information.
     36 """
     37 
     38 import struct
     39 import sys
     40 import os
     41 from google.protobuf import message
     42 from google.protobuf import json_format
     43 import conformance_pb2
     44 
     45 sys.stdout = os.fdopen(sys.stdout.fileno(), 'wb', 0)
     46 sys.stdin = os.fdopen(sys.stdin.fileno(), 'rb', 0)
     47 
     48 test_count = 0
     49 verbose = False
     50 
     51 class ProtocolError(Exception):
     52   pass
     53 
     54 def do_test(request):
     55   test_message = conformance_pb2.TestAllTypes()
     56   response = conformance_pb2.ConformanceResponse()
     57   test_message = conformance_pb2.TestAllTypes()
     58 
     59   try:
     60     if request.WhichOneof('payload') == 'protobuf_payload':
     61       try:
     62         test_message.ParseFromString(request.protobuf_payload)
     63       except message.DecodeError as e:
     64         response.parse_error = str(e)
     65         return response
     66 
     67     elif request.WhichOneof('payload') == 'json_payload':
     68       try:
     69         json_format.Parse(request.json_payload, test_message)
     70       except json_format.ParseError as e:
     71         response.parse_error = str(e)
     72         return response
     73 
     74     else:
     75       raise ProtocolError("Request didn't have payload.")
     76 
     77     if request.requested_output_format == conformance_pb2.UNSPECIFIED:
     78       raise ProtocolError("Unspecified output format")
     79 
     80     elif request.requested_output_format == conformance_pb2.PROTOBUF:
     81       response.protobuf_payload = test_message.SerializeToString()
     82 
     83     elif request.requested_output_format == conformance_pb2.JSON:
     84       response.json_payload = json_format.MessageToJson(test_message)
     85 
     86   except Exception as e:
     87     response.runtime_error = str(e)
     88 
     89   return response
     90 
     91 def do_test_io():
     92   length_bytes = sys.stdin.read(4)
     93   if len(length_bytes) == 0:
     94     return False   # EOF
     95   elif len(length_bytes) != 4:
     96     raise IOError("I/O error")
     97 
     98   # "I" is "unsigned int", so this depends on running on a platform with
     99   # 32-bit "unsigned int" type.  The Python struct module unfortunately
    100   # has no format specifier for uint32_t.
    101   length = struct.unpack("<I", length_bytes)[0]
    102   serialized_request = sys.stdin.read(length)
    103   if len(serialized_request) != length:
    104     raise IOError("I/O error")
    105 
    106   request = conformance_pb2.ConformanceRequest()
    107   request.ParseFromString(serialized_request)
    108 
    109   response = do_test(request)
    110 
    111   serialized_response = response.SerializeToString()
    112   sys.stdout.write(struct.pack("<I", len(serialized_response)))
    113   sys.stdout.write(serialized_response)
    114   sys.stdout.flush()
    115 
    116   if verbose:
    117     sys.stderr.write("conformance_python: request=%s, response=%s\n" % (
    118                        request.ShortDebugString().c_str(),
    119                        response.ShortDebugString().c_str()))
    120 
    121   global test_count
    122   test_count += 1
    123 
    124   return True
    125 
    126 while True:
    127   if not do_test_io():
    128     sys.stderr.write("conformance_python: received EOF from test runner " +
    129                      "after %s tests, exiting\n" % (test_count))
    130     sys.exit(0)
